Boot your A1000 with TwinKick (Aminet).
During (os1.3) resets you are able to disable all expansions (ext. diskdrives, hdds, memory) by holding both mousebuttons.
You will see a short colorflash for the "gaming-mode".
With the next reset all expansions are available again.
(Or you can jump directly to os3.1 )

Disabling fastmem with nofastmem + addmem will crash the system with a corrupted memlist.

Disabling memory with TwinKick + addmem is possible.
